Break the Cycle: Effective Strategies for Gambling Debt Management

Gambling addiction can quickly spiral out of control, leaving individuals drowning in debt. It's a painful situation that can harm relationships and your economic well-being. The first step to recovery is acknowledging the problem and seeking support. There are effective methods to manage gambling debt and begin recovering your life.

  • Develop a budget and stick to it, reducing spending on non-essential items.
  • Reach out to a credit counselor or financial advisor for professional guidance.
  • Negotiate with creditors to consider payment plans that are manageable.
  • Explore debt consolidation options to simplify your finances.
  • Ultimately, seek support from loved ones and/or a counseling group for gambling addiction.
